Virginia Big Woods WMA, New Parker’s Branch Tract Open
by TBC Press on 11/15/16The Virginia Department of Game and Inland Fisheries (DGIF) announced that it has purchased 1,965 acres in Sussex County, Virginia, adjoining the existing Big Woods Wildlife Management Area and Big Woods State Forest. The area is predominantly upland loblolly pine forests and mature forest swamps. The habitat supports a wide range of wildlife species including white-tailed deer, eastern wild turkey, bobwhite quail, brown-headed nuthatch, red-headed and pileated woodpeckers, summer tanager, and a variety of warblers.
